DB, or Deutsch Bonnet, emerged post-WWII in France, the brainchild of Charles Deutsch and René Bonnet.
Initially, they focused on modifying existing vehicles for racing, achieving success in the early 1950s.
Their cars were known for their lightweight construction and aerodynamic designs.
A lesser-known fact: DB cars achieved remarkable fuel economy. In the 1950s, a DB set a fuel consumption record, traveling from Paris to Nice on a ridiculously small amount of fuel. This feat showcased their engineering prowess beyond just speed.
